What Is the Battery Rebate?

The battery rebate refers to government‑supported financial incentives designed to lower the upfront cost of installing battery storage systems. These can include:

  • State-level rebates, such as the SA Sustainability Incentives Scheme, offer up to 50% off—capped at $2,000—for battery installations in Adelaide.
  • Federal rebates, such as the upcoming Cheaper Home Batteries Program, are set to begin on 1 July 2025, offering around a 30% reduction in battery costs.

Together, these battery rebate opportunities significantly reduce investment barriers in home energy storage.

State Incentives: The SA Battery Rebate in Detail

Even though the previous Home Battery Scheme is now closed, Adelaide residents still benefit from a robust battery rebate program:

  • 50% off installation costs, up to $2,000 per household under the Sustainability Incentives Scheme.
  • Applies to grid-connected homes—including rentals, with landlord approval
  • Concession card holders receive higher rebates per kWh, maximising value

This battery rebate significantly reduces the cost, making storage more accessible and cost-effective.

Federal Support: Cheaper Home Batteries Program

Set to commence on 1 July 2025, the Australian Government’s battery rebate initiative will:

  • Offer approximately 30% off the upfront cost via Small-scale Technology Certificates (STCs) under the SRES.
  • Provide roughly $335 per usable kWh in 2025, tapering in value through 2030.
  • Offer up to 50 kWh battery capacities, catering to both homes and small businesses.

Combined with Adelaide’s state rebate, the battery rebate potential becomes even more compelling.

Eligibility and Path to Access

To qualify for the battery rebate, applicants must meet these core conditions:

  • Grid connection: The property must be connected to the electricity grid.
  • Clean Energy Council (CEC) approved battery and accredited installer.
  • Site inspection and Certificate of Electrical Compliance obtained on or after 1 July 2025 for federal eligibility:
  • VPP compliance-ready: Must be capable of integration with Virtual Power Plant networks; connection is optional.
  • One rebate per household, with concessions often amplified for eligible low-income or concession card holders.

By aligning with accredited professionals, property owners can seamlessly capture all available incentives and avoid regulatory missteps.

Why Now Is an Ideal Time

  • Timing: Federal rebates begin on 1 July 2025. Installers can pre-install, but the system must be activated after July to access full federal battery rebate benefits.
  • High upfront savings: Combined rebates of $5,000–$6,500 substantially reduce system costs.
  • Grid and cost resilience: A smarter, sun-powered Adelaide grid benefits both individual consumers and the public.
  • Rising energy prices: More households can finally justify upfront expenditure with shorter payback periods.

Strategic Considerations

When planning battery installation in Adelaide:

  • Capacity planning: Choose between smaller (5–6 kWh) or larger batteries (up to 13.5 kWh) based on daily consumption, essential loads, and blackout risks.
  • Inverter compatibility and upgrades: Older solar arrays may require inverter upgrades, which can increase the overall cost of the system.
  • Installer selection: Choose CEC-accredited installers with experience navigating battery rebate programs.
  • Feed-in tariffs: Supplemented by energy export tariffs in South Australia—typically 5–10 c/kWh.
  • VPP participation: Optional virtual power plant integration may yield extra credits or future-proof grid value.

Future Outlook and Declining Value

  • Rebate tapering: The federal rebate value declines annually through 2030, from $302/kWh in 2026 to $266 in 2027 and then down to $169/kWh in 2030.
  • Escalating battery market maturity: As battery prices fall, rebates become relatively minor, but state and installation costs still justify early adoption.
  • Policy evolution: The energy roadmap and grid-related dynamics (e.g., Project EnergyConnect) indicate longer-term growth in battery-backed systems in SA.
